Инструмент
Google Cloud AI Platform
10365
344
4.7
Создавайте, обучайте и развёртывайте AI-модели легко с мощными алгоритмами ML и безопасной инфраструктурой. Начните прямо сейчас!
снимки экрана
Не смогли решить свои задачи этой нейросетью?
Отзывы
- АС
Анна Смирнова
15 ноября 2023 г.
Пользуемся Google Cloud AI Platform для обучения наших рекомендательных моделей. Масштабируемость просто поражает — мы смогли обработать огромные объемы данных без проблем. Интеграция с BigQuery работает без нареканий, что очень удобно для наших аналитических задач. Единственный минус — начальный порог входа может быть высоким для новичков в облаке.
- ДК
Дмитрий Козлов
20 января 2024 г.
Отличная платформа для ML инженеров. Люблю AI Platform Notebooks за простоту развертывания и возможность использовать GPU прямо из коробки. Документация обширная, но иногда очень детализированная, что требует времени на поиск нужной информации. Цены могут быть немного выше, чем у конкурентов, но стабильность и производительность того стоят. Хотелось бы побольше готовых шаблонов.
- ЕП
Елена Петрова
1 марта 2024 г.
Мы используем AI Platform Prediction для нашего сервиса распознавания изображений. Модели разворачиваются быстро и работают стабильно. Особенно ценю инструменты мониторинга, которые помогают отслеживать производительность моделей в продакшене. Поддержка TensorFlow и PyTorch позволяет нам легко мигрировать наши существующие проекты. Это одно из лучших решений для MLOps, с которыми я работала.
Google Cloud AI Platform
Что такое Google Cloud AI Platform
Google Cloud AI Platform (ныне чаще интегрированная в Vertex AI) – это комплексная управляемая платформа для разработки, развертывания и масштабирования моделей машинного обучения. Она предоставляет набор инструментов и сервисов, позволяющих специалистам по данным и разработчикам создавать, обучать и внедрять свои AI-приложения в производственную среду, используя мощные вычислительные ресурсы Google Cloud.
Описание сервиса Google Cloud AI Platform
Google Cloud AI Platform была разработана для упрощения полного жизненного цикла машинного обучения – от подготовки данных до мониторинга моделей в продакшене. Платформа стремится демократизировать доступ к AI, предоставляя как высокоуровневые API для быстрых решений, так и низкоуровневые инструменты для тонкой настройки и кастомизации. Её основная цель – сократить время от идеи до реализации, позволяя командам сосредоточиться на создании ценности, а не на управлении инфраструктурой. Она обеспечивает единую среду для всех этапов ML-проекта, существенно повышая эффективность и производительность.
Ключевые особенности Google Cloud AI Platform
- Единая платформа для полного цикла ML: от подготовки данных до развёртывания.
- Масштабируемая инфраструктура: автоматическое управление ресурсами для обучения и развёртывания моделей.
- Поддержка популярных фреймворков: TensorFlow, PyTorch, scikit-learn и других.
- Управляемые сервисы: снижение операционной нагрузки на разработчиков.
- Интеграция с другими сервисами Google Cloud: BigQuery, Cloud Storage, Dataflow и т.д.
- MLOps-возможности: автоматизация рабочих процессов, мониторинг моделей, контроль версий.
Основные функции Google Cloud AI Platform
- AI Platform Training: Сервис для распределенного обучения моделей с использованием виртуальных машин и GPU.
- AI Platform Prediction: Инструменты для развертывания обученных моделей в виде веб-сервисов и получения предсказаний в реальном времени или пакетами.
- AI Platform Notebooks: Управляемые экземпляры JupyterLab для интерактивной разработки и экспериментов.
- AI Platform Data Labeling: Сервис для создания высококачественных наборов данных с разметкой.
- AI Platform Pipelines: Оркестрация рабочих процессов машинного обучения на базе Kubeflow Pipelines.
- Объяснимый ИИ (Explainable AI): Инструменты для понимания того, как модель принимает решения.
Задачи и проблемы, которые решает Google Cloud AI Platform
Платформа Google Cloud AI решает множество задач, связанных с машинным обучением, таких как:
- Сложность управления инфраструктурой для обучения и развёртывания больших моделей.
- Трудности с масштабированием вычислений для объемных наборов данных.
- Необходимость стандартизации рабочих процессов ML и обеспечения воспроизводимости экспериментов.
- Проблемы с интеграцией ML-моделей в существующие приложения.
- Снижение затрат и времени на разработку и поддержку AI-решений.
Примеры и сценарии использования Google Cloud AI Platform
- Построение рекомендательных систем: Компании электронной коммерции могут использовать AI Platform для обучения моделей, которые предлагают персонализированные товары покупателям, анализируя их историю покупок и просмотров. Это повышает конверсию и удовлетворенность клиентов.
- Прогнозирование спроса и оптимизация запасов: Ритейлеры и логистические компании применяют платформу для создания и развёртывания моделей прогнозирования будущего спроса на основе исторических данных, погодных условий и рекламных акций. Это позволяет оптимизировать складские запасы и снизить издержки.
- Анализ изображений и видео для контроля качества: В производстве можно использовать AI Platform для разработки систем компьютерного зрения, которые автоматически обнаруживают дефекты на производственных линиях, анализируя изображения или видеоматериалы. Это значительно улучшает качество продукции и сокращает количество брака.
Целевая аудитория Google Cloud AI Platform
- Специалисты по данным (Data Scientists) и ML-инженеры: Для них платформа предоставляет мощные инструменты для разработки, обучения и экспериментирования с моделями.
- Разработчики приложений: Могут легко интегрировать функции AI в свои приложения через API.
- Архитекторы решений: Используют платформу для проектирования масштабируемых и надежных AI-систем.
- Предприятия и стартапы: Любые компании, стремящиеся внедрить машинное обучение в свои бизнес-процессы, от небольших команд до крупных корпораций.
- Исследователи: Для проведения масштабных исследований и экспериментов с ML-моделями.
Уникальные преимущества Google Cloud AI Platform
Уникальные преимущества Google Cloud AI Platform заключаются в глубокой интеграции с обширной экосистемой Google Cloud, предоставляя бесшовный доступ к инструментам обработки данных, хранения и аналитики. Доступ к передовым исследованиям Google в области AI, таким как Tensor Processing Units (TPU), позволяет достигать высокой производительности и экономии. Управляемый характер платформы минимизирует операционные задачи, позволяя командам сосредоточиться на создании инноваций, а не на администрировании инфраструктуры.
Плюсы Google Cloud AI Platform
- Полный цикл ML: от данных до развертывания.
- Высокая масштабируемость и производительность.
- Поддержка open-source фреймворков.
- Управляемые сервисы снижают операционные расходы.
- Глубокая интеграция с Google Cloud.
- Мощные инструменты для MLOps.
- Доступ к передовым разработкам Google AI.
Минусы Google Cloud AI Platform
- Кривая обучения для новых пользователей Google Cloud.
- Стоимость может быть высокой при больших объемах использования.
- Зависимость от экосистемы Google Cloud.
- Некоторые функции требуют глубоких знаний в ML.
- Сложность миграции существующих решений с других платформ.
Технологии, используемые в Google Cloud AI Platform
Google Cloud AI Platform опирается на передовые технологии, разработанные Google и сообществом открытого исходного кода. В её основе лежат такие фреймворки, как TensorFlow и PyTorch, а также scikit-learn. Для распределенных вычислений используются мощные виртуальные машины, включая GPU и специализированные Tensor Processing Units (TPU). Платформа активно использует контейнеризацию с помощью Docker и оркестрацию Kubernetes. API-интерфейсы позволяют управлять ресурсами программно, а интеграция с другими сервисами Google Cloud, такими как BigQuery и Cloud Storage, образует мощную связку для сквозной обработки данных и моделей.
Интеграции и совместимость Google Cloud AI Platform
Google Cloud AI Platform тесно интегрирована с целым рядом сервисов Google Cloud, включая:
- Google Cloud Storage: Для хранения данных и моделей.
- BigQuery: Для работы с крупными аналитическими данными.
- Dataflow: Для обработки и трансформации данных.
- Cloud Functions: Для бессерверных вычислений и автоматизации.
- Kubernetes Engine (GKE): Для развертывания и управления контейнеризованными приложениями.
- Operations Suite (бывший Stackdriver): Для мониторинга и логирования. Поддерживаются популярные библиотеки и фреймворки Machine Learning, что обеспечивает высокую совместимость с существующими проектами.
Стоимость и тарифы Google Cloud AI Platform
Стоимость использования Google Cloud AI Platform основана на модели оплаты по мере использования (pay-as-you-go). Тарифы зависят от потребляемых ресурсов: времени использования вычислительных мощностей (CPU, GPU, TPU), объема хранимых данных, количества запросов к моделям предсказания. Для новых пользователей доступен бесплатный уровень (Free Tier), который позволяет ознакомиться с платформой и протестировать её базовые функции без дополнительных затрат до определенного лимита. Подробные расценки доступны на официальном сайте Google Cloud и могут меняться в зависимости от региона и типа используемого сервиса.
Безопасность и конфиденциальность Google Cloud AI Platform
Google Cloud AI Platform обеспечивает высокий уровень безопасности и конфиденциальности данных. Используются стандартные для Google Cloud механизмы шифрования данных во время передачи и в состоянии покоя. Управление доступом осуществляется через Identity and Access Management (IAM), позволяя гибко настраивать разрешения для пользователей и сервисных аккаунтов. Google придерживается международных стандартов безопасности и соответствия, таких как ISO 27001, SOC 1/2/3, GDPR и других, что гарантирует защиту пользовательских данных и моделей.
Аналоги и конкуренты Google Cloud AI Platform
Основными конкурентами Google Cloud AI Platform являются облачные платформы других крупных провайдеров. Среди них: Amazon SageMaker (AWS), Azure Machine Learning (Microsoft Azure), IBM Watson Studio. Google Cloud AI Platform выделяется благодаря глубокой интеграции с уникальными разработками Google в сфере ИИ (например, TPU), обширной экосистемой Google Cloud и strong-позиционированием в области MLOps. Каждый из конкурентов имеет свои сильные стороны, но AI Platform активно развивается, предлагая передовые решения для полного цикла ML.
Отзывы и репутация Google Cloud AI Platform
Пользователи Google Cloud AI Platform часто отмечают её мощные возможности масштабирования и богатый набор инструментов. Платформа имеет хорошую репутацию в кругах профессионалов в области машинного обучения и аналитики данных. Хотя иногда присутствует сложность в освоении для новичков, общая оценка очень позитивная, особенно для крупных корпоративных проектов. Чаще всего выделяют:
- Масштабируемость
- Интеграции с экосистемой Google
- Гибкость
- Инновационность
- Надежность
Страна разработчика Google Cloud AI Platform
Разработчиком Google Cloud AI Platform является компания Google, штаб-квартира которой находится в США.
Поддерживаемые платформы Google Cloud AI Platform
Google Cloud AI Platform является облачным сервисом и не требует установки на локальные компьютеры или серверы. Доступ к ней осуществляется через веб-консоль Google Cloud Console, API и CLI-инструменты. Таким образом, сервис поддерживается на любой операционной системе (Windows, macOS, Linux) и любом современном веб-браузере, имеющем доступ к интернету. Разработка моделей может происходить в различных средах, включая Jupyter/JupyterLab в облачных Notebooks.
История и происхождение Google Cloud AI Platform
Google Cloud AI Platform первоначально была запущена в 2017 году как Google Cloud ML Engine. Впоследствии она была расширена и переименована, включив в себя больше сервисов для полного жизненного цикла машинного обучения. Целью создания платформы было предоставление унифицированного решения для разработки AI-приложений, используя богатый опыт Google в области искусственного интеллекта. В мае 2021 года Google объединила свои основные инструменты ML-платформы под брендом Vertex AI, что стало дальнейшим развитием и обогащением функционала AI Platform, предложив еще более интегрированный и управляемый подход к ML-Ops.
Контактная информация Google Cloud AI Platform
Вся актуальная информация о способах связи, поддержке и сообществах Google Cloud AI Platform доступна на официальном сайте Google Cloud по соответствующим разделам.